What are particles not arranged in a regular pattern?

Particles that are not arranged in a regular pattern are typically found in amorphous materials. In amorphous solids, the particles are randomly arranged and lack a long-range order seen in crystalline solids. Examples of amorphous materials include glass, certain polymers, and gels.

Are crystalline and amorphous solids?

Crystalline Solids are when the particles form a regular repeating pattern. Amorphous solids have particles that are not arranged in a regular pattern.

What is the name given to the regular pattern in witch an ionic compound is arranged?

The regular pattern in which an ionic compound is arranged is called a crystal lattice structure. It is formed by the repeated arrangement of positively and negatively charged ions in a three-dimensional geometric pattern.
